Friday Match Roundup

By on April 19, 2013

Today there have been three top-flight matches, the Spanish La Liga match between Mallorca and Rayo Vallecano, the German Bundesliga match between Borussia Monchengladbach and FC Augsburg, and the French Ligue 1 match between Montpellier and Lyon.  The final scores were Mallorca 1-1 Rayo Vallecano, with Mallorca earning a crucial draw as the battle against relegation, Borussia Monchengladbach 1-0 FC Augsburg, with Monchengladbach edging into sixth place, and Montpellier 2-1 Lyon, with Clément Grenier ninety-third minute winner taking Lyon into second place and being a huge boost for their hopes of the Champions League.
